Se descubre un bug de 25 años de edad en BSD

Parece que no pueda ser, pero es, Marc Balmer, desarrollador de OpeenBSD fue avisado vía e-Mail sobre un fallo en Samba que un usuario había tenido al intentar acceder a ficheros dentro de un servidor Unix desde MS-DOS.

Para los que no saben qué es Samba, solamente decir que es un protocolo de intercambio entre Unux y Windows, cuya utilidad es acceder a archivos, compartirlos, intercambiarlos…

Entonces, Balmer (que no Ballmer), se puso en contacto con los desarroladores de Samba, que le dijeron que podía tratarse de un bug, cosa que explicaría el error del usuario que lo reportó.

La sorprendente conclusión a la que llegó fue que ése bug estaba presente en el código desde…¡¡¡1983!!!, o lo que es lo mismo, desde la versión 4.2 de BSD (con lo que el bug había estado allí desde el momento que que se había creado el código).

Por supuesto, es muy probable que el bug haya estado explotado por crackers, pero no es seguro, ya que no todos los bugs pueden ser penetrados como un fallo de seguridad.

Si se quiere corregir el error, en el blog de Balmer hay la solución.

En cualquier caso,el bug tiene más años que un servidor, así que me quito el sombrero ante tal silencioso error.

Fuente: Linuxeando

Comparte esta entrada

Fuente: http://linux.adslzone.net/2008/05/25/se-descubre-un-bug-de-25-anos-de-edad-en-bsd/

leer más